If you’ve ever spent time in Roslyn, you’ve probably spotted The Brick Saloon at 100 West Pennsylvania Avenue. And while it’s clear at first glance that this building has a lot of history, most don’t know it’s as old as the state itself… and even fewer know it’s haunted.
The Brick was built in 1889, the same year Washington became a state.
The Brick Saloon Facebook It was rebuilt in 1898 using 45,000 bricks, hence its name.
Inside you’ll find a cozy, rustic space, and a shining 100-year-old back bar from England.
Barbara O / TripAdvisor And according to local legend, that’s not all you might see.
Both the current manager and owner and the former owner of The Brick have experienced paranormal activity here.
Barbara O / TripAdvisor Employees and patrons alike have spotted a little girl and a cowboy, and there’s a piano that sometimes plays by itself.
One former bartender got so freaked out by the paranormal activity that he quit on the spot, according to the current owner.
The Brick Saloon Facebook While all activity seems to indicate the local spirits are friendly, the bartender wasn’t taking his chances.
Whether or not this historic saloon is actually haunted, it’s definitely a great place to enjoy a cold beer and a hot meal.
